Wider weather episode
During the late evening on the 20th, thunderstorms produced heavy rain over the Vamori Wash. Radar estimated indicated 3-5 inches of rain fell along the border of Arizona and Mexico and a broader area of 2-3 inches fell over the village of Vamori and Cowlic. Tohono O'odham dispatch reported five home had been flooded in the village of Vamori. NWS survey team reported high water marks at 2.5 feet on several of the homes. The Vamori Was gage at Kom Vo peaked at 8.5 feet, where bankfull stage is 8.0 feet.
